Food quality is a split
Dining reviews are mixed, ranging from good and controlled diets to inedible meals.
Several residents and families say the food works for their needs, including controlled or special diets. Others report meals being inedible or cold, and describe poor food quality in strong terms. A couple of reviews specifically call out diabetes-related meal concerns, including being told diabetics would be served the same as everyone else.

Staff responsiveness varies widely
Staff experiences range from attentive and cheerful to non-responsive and dismissive.
Many reviews describe staff as professional, helpful, cheerful, and willing to answer questions. Several others describe non-responsive care, rude behavior, and neglect that left residents waiting or unfixed for hours. Even when people praised caregivers, at least a few reviews note communication problems or inconsistency across shifts.

Cleanliness and room condition
Reviews mention both very clean spaces and serious cleanliness and odor issues.
Some residents and families describe the facility as clean, bright, and well maintained, including room setups that were easy to use. Other reviewers report dirty rooms, unpleasant smells, and visibly worn or shabby furnishings. At least one review also describes hygiene and bathroom conditions as alarming.

Rehab and therapy results differ
Rehab therapy is praised in some reviews and called ineffective in others.
Multiple reviews credit the therapy team with improving recovery and helping residents regain function after surgery or injury. Others describe physical therapy as a joke, not seeing therapists for extended stretches, or feeling they got worse under wound and rehab care. One review also reports a rapid decline after a short stay that sent the resident back to the hospital.

Communication and monitoring concerns
Some reviews cite missed monitoring and weak communication with families.
Several negative reviews focus on care coordination problems, including delays or missed checks such as blood sugar monitoring. Others mention difficulties getting answers about medications and the rehab plan, and describe meetings or follow-through not happening as expected. A few reviewers also say they experienced inconsistent staffing presence when they tried to ask for help.

Pneumonia significantly affects older adults due to weakened immune systems and atypical symptoms that complicate diagnosis, necessitating early detection and tailored treatment. Risk factors include chronic diseases and cognitive impairments, with preventive measures like vaccinations and healthy lifestyles being crucial for reducing risk.
Palliative care enhances the quality of life for seriously ill patients by providing comprehensive support at home through a multidisciplinary team, addressing various needs and prioritizing comfort over curative treatments. While it offers personalized care and involves family in decision-making, challenges like caregiver stress and logistical issues persist, with growing demand prompting advancements in technology and healthcare policies to improve access.
Palliative home care focuses on improving the quality of life for individuals with serious illnesses by providing comfort, symptom management, and emotional support in their own homes. This approach includes personalized care plans, regular assessments, and resources for family caregivers, all while prioritizing person-centered treatment that aligns with patients' goals.
